Biological background (from provided description)
CLIC4 antibody targets chloride intracellular channel protein 4, a member of the CLIC family of proteins that function as intracellular chloride channels and signaling modulators. Unlike classical ion channels, CLIC4 can exist in both soluble and membrane-associated forms, transitioning between states to regulate chloride conductance.
